What proof of relationship is needed for extension?

Gefragt von: Timo Sander
sternezahl: 4.2/5 (17 sternebewertungen)

To extend a visa based on a relationship, you typically need to prove that the relationship is genuine and subsisting (ongoing). The specific evidence required often depends on the country's immigration authority (such as UK Visas and Immigration or German foreigners authorities), but generally includes official documents and shared life evidence.

What documents are required for residence permit extension in Germany?

To extend your German residence permit, you'll generally need your valid passport, current biometric photos, completed application form, proof of residence (Anmeldung), health insurance proof, and financial proof (blocked account/payslips), plus specific documents for your status like enrollment certificates for students or employment contracts for workers, submitted to your local Ausländerbehörde (Foreigners' Office). Always check your local office's website for exact requirements as they vary. 

Can a dependant apply for an extension?

If you're in the UK as a dependant of a Skilled Worker, Student, or Spouse visa holder, you can apply for a dependant visa extension UK as long as: The main visa holder remains eligible and in the UK. You continue to meet relationship and financial requirements. You apply before your current visa expires.

What are the supporting evidences for a partner visa?

Household evidence for a partner visa

Documents that show joint ownership of residential property. Joint lease agreements. Rent payment receipts or evidence of shared rental payments via bank statements. Joint utilities accounts and other household bills, e.g. electricity, gas, water, phone, internet, subscriptions.

What is proof of address for visa extension?

a tenancy agreement, utility bills or Council Tax bills confirming that you live at the same address or pay bills together. a bank statement from a joint bank account, or confirming that you live at the same address. a letter from your doctor or dentist confirming that you live at the same address.

What can you use as proof of relationship?

Key Categories of Proof of Relationship Documents

  • Marriage or Civil Partnership Certificate.
  • Communication History.
  • Travel and Visits.
  • Photographs Together.
  • Letters from Friends or Family.
  • Shared Financial or Domestic Documents.
  • Official Correspondence to the Same Address.
